Here's what I did (at least before the local airport made it legally impossible to be an independent CFI):

Flat rate for CFI.....................................................20/hr
2/ hr more for each 100 hrs of dual given.............80/hr
Specialized experience (airline pilot, additional instructor ratings, etc at 2/ hr for each................................................8/hr

As you can see, it becomes too much per the formula after a while, so you have to be reasonable...I stopped at 45/ hr.

What is important is that the student realize that your time is valuable. I billed from show time to when we parted, except for lunch if we had it. Why? Because:
1. Forces stdt to be on time for lesson.
2. Stdts will spend 45 minutes of YOUR time making small talk. You are unavailable to anyone else during this booking, and the stdt wants you for free by samll talking with a question peppered in here and there? No way Jose.
3. You position yourself as a professional.
4. The student will expect (and deserves) professional instruction.
